Tee | Par | Length | Rating | Slope |
---|---|---|---|---|
Blue | 71 | 6709 yards | 71.5 | 125 |
White | 71 | 6220 yards | 69.6 | 120 |
Gold | 71 | 5430 yards | 66.1 | 113 |
Red (W) | 71 | 5082 yards | 70.2 | 118 |

Getting better
They have changed the layout now the back 9 is the front 9 which messed up my Gps at first. The course is a long one and not many short holes with the par 3's being over 200 yards.
There are about 5 holes that dog leg left and the straight holes have either sand or water hazards to work around to add to the challenge.
